Explore Different Types of Disposable Hand Gloves

Not every glove is suitable for every task. Understanding the differences between glove materials can help you choose the right option for your workplace.

  • Vinyl Gloves: A practical choice for general food handling, food preparation, and other light-duty tasks.
  • Nitrile Gloves: Designed for greater durability, flexibility, and resistance to punctures compared with lighter disposable options.
  • Poly or Plastic Gloves: Ideal for quick food-handling tasks where frequent glove changes are required.
  • Black Kitchen Gloves: A professional-looking option commonly used in commercial kitchens, catering operations, and food preparation environments.

When selecting disposable hand gloves, consider the type of work, frequency of glove changes, required durability, and fit.

Choosing Gloves Based on the Task

The right glove depends on how and where it will be used. Here is a simple guide to help businesses compare common options:

Task

Glove Type to Consider

Quick food handling

Plastic or poly gloves

General food preparation

Vinyl gloves

More demanding kitchen tasks

Nitrile gloves

Light cleaning tasks

Suitable cleaning gloves based on the task and cleaning product

Tasks requiring frequent glove changes

Disposable hand gloves

For cleaning work, always check the cleaning product label and glove manufacturer information to determine whether the glove material is suitable for the task.

Plastic Gloves for Quick and Convenient Food Handling

Plastic gloves are a convenient option for short-duration tasks where workers need to change gloves regularly. Their simple design makes them useful in fast-moving food service environments.

They can be a practical choice for tasks such as sandwich preparation, bakery counter service, deli handling, assembling takeout orders, and other quick food-handling activities.

For longer tasks or work requiring greater durability, another glove material, such as vinyl or nitrile, may be more appropriate.

FAQs 

1. What Types Of Disposable Gloves Are Available?

Ans: Disposable gloves are available in several materials, including nitrile, vinyl, and plastic or poly. Each material has different characteristics and is suited to different applications, including food handling, food preparation, and selected cleaning tasks.

2. Which Gloves Are Best For Food Preparation And Kitchen Use?

Ans: The best choice depends on the task. Plastic or poly gloves are useful for quick food-handling jobs and frequent changes. Vinyl gloves are a practical option for many general food preparation tasks, while nitrile gloves are often selected when greater durability and a closer fit are needed.

3. What Are Black Kitchen Gloves Used For?

Ans: Black kitchen gloves are commonly used for food preparation, catering, cooking, and other professional kitchen tasks. They are particularly popular in open kitchens and customer-facing food preparation areas because of their professional appearance.

5. What Is The Difference Between Plastic, Vinyl, And Nitrile Gloves?

Ans: Plastic or poly gloves are lightweight and suitable for quick tasks and frequent glove changes. Vinyl gloves are commonly used for general food handling and light-duty work. Nitrile gloves typically provide greater durability and puncture resistance than lightweight plastic options.

6. Can Disposable Gloves Be Used For Cleaning Tasks?

Ans: Some disposable gloves may be suitable for light cleaning tasks, but the correct glove depends on the cleaning product and type of work. Always review the cleaning product label and glove manufacturer information before use.

7. How Do I Choose The Correct Size Of Disposable Hand Gloves?

Ans: Choose gloves that fit securely without feeling too tight or too loose. Gloves that are too tight may be uncomfortable during extended use, while loose gloves can make handling tasks more difficult. Check the available sizing information before ordering bulk quantities.
